Understanding the McDonald's Verification Gateway

Fast-food apps handle millions of automated orders, loyalty reward redemptions, and digital coupon claims every single hour. To prevent automated scripts from creating bulk accounts to exploit free burger deals, their security architecture enforces strict phone verification rules. When you enter a phone number on the sign-up screen, the app queries carrier databases to check if the prefix belongs to a traditional mobile carrier or a virtual internet-based service.

If the system detects a flagged prefix, the server halts the SMS dispatch process. You won't see an explicit warning explaining that VoIP numbers are banned. Instead, the screen simply states that something went wrong or asks you to try again later. This silent rejection confuses many users who assume the app is experiencing a temporary network outage.

Real verification depends entirely on carrier routing. Traditional mobile numbers receive texts via cellular towers, while virtual numbers receive them via cloud-based software interfaces. Common Failure Modes When Receiving Fast-Food OTPs

Even when using a paid virtual line, text delivery can occasionally stall. Knowing the root cause helps you troubleshoot faster without wasting money on repeated attempts.

  • Carrier Lag: High network congestion during peak lunch or dinner hours can delay short-code delivery by up to two minutes.
  • IP Address Mismatch: If your browser's VPN region does not match the country code of the virtual phone number, the verification script may flag the request as suspicious.
  • Recycled Number Conflict: If the previous owner of the temporary number registered a McDonald's account years ago, you might trigger a multi-factor authentication prompt instead of a clean sign-up flow.
  • Short-Code Filtering: Some virtual carriers block incoming messages from 5-digit short codes to prevent spam, which accidentally blocks the exact OTP you need.

If your code fails to arrive within 60 seconds, do not keep spamming the resend button. Fast-food authentication systems implement rate-limiting penalties. If you request a new code four times in a row, the server locks your IP address and phone number combination for up to 24 hours.
